NK-33s to Power Kistler K-1s

Early next year, Aerojet will start modifying 12 Russian NK-33 rocket engines for use as the first and second stages of a new Kistler Aerospace Corp. launch vehicle. The first 12 of 70 NK-33s were delivered to Sacramento, Calif., in late August on board an Antonov An-124 aircraft. Aerojet acquired...
